Environmental Impact of Traditional Roofing Materials

As you delve deeper into the world of roofing, it becomes evident that traditional materials often have a significant environmental impact. Asphalt shingles, for instance, are one of the most commonly used roofing materials but come with considerable drawbacks. The production of asphalt shingles involves the extraction of petroleum, a non-renewable resource, which contributes to greenhouse gas emissions.

Moreover, once these shingles reach the end of their life cycle, they often end up in landfills, where they can take decades to decompose. How Flat-foam or Single Ply Roofing Helps Reduce Energy Costs

One of the most appealing aspects of flat-foam or single-ply roofing is its potential to reduce energy costs significantly. These roofing systems often feature reflective surfaces that help to deflect sunlight rather than absorb it. This reflective quality can lead to lower cooling costs during hot summer months, as your air conditioning system won’t have to work as hard to maintain a comfortable indoor temperature.

Additionally, many flat-foam and single-ply roofs are designed with excellent insulation properties. This means that they can help keep your home warm during winter months by preventing heat loss. As a result, you may notice a substantial decrease in your heating bills as well.

The Process of Installing Flat-foam or Single Ply Roofing

Understanding the installation process of flat-foam or single-ply roofing can help you feel more confident in your decision to choose these materials for your home. The installation typically begins with a thorough inspection of your existing roof structure to ensure it can support the new system. Once any necessary repairs are made, the installation team will prepare the surface by cleaning it and applying any required insulation.

Next comes the application of the flat-foam or single-ply material itself. This process usually involves rolling out large sheets of material and securing them in place using adhesives or mechanical fasteners. The seams between sheets are then sealed to create a watertight barrier.

Finally, a protective coating may be applied to enhance durability and reflectivity. Throughout this process, it’s essential to work with experienced professionals who understand the nuances of eco-friendly roofing installation.

Maintenance and Care for Eco-friendly Roofing

While eco-friendly roofing systems like flat-foam or single-ply roofs are designed for durability and longevity, regular maintenance is still essential to ensure they perform at their best. One of the simplest yet most effective maintenance tasks is routine inspections. By checking for any signs of wear or damage after severe weather events or at least twice a year, you can catch potential issues early before they escalate into costly repairs.

Cleaning is another critical aspect of maintaining your eco-friendly roof. Debris such as leaves, branches, and dirt can accumulate over time and hinder drainage or cause damage if left unchecked. Regularly clearing off debris will help maintain the integrity of your roof while also enhancing its appearance.

FAQs

What is flat-foam roofing?

Flat-foam roofing is a type of roofing system that involves the application of a spray polyurethane foam (SPF) directly onto the roof deck. This foam expands and solidifies, creating a seamless, waterproof barrier that insulates the building and protects it from the elements.

What is single ply roofing?

Single ply roofing is a type of roofing system that uses a single layer of flexible membrane as the primary covering for the roof. This membrane is typically made of synthetic polymer materials such as PVC, TPO, or EPDM, and is installed in a single layer without the need for multiple layers or coatings.

What are the eco-friendly benefits of flat-foam roofing?

Flat-foam roofing is considered eco-friendly because it can improve a building’s energy efficiency by providing insulation and reducing the need for heating and cooling. Additionally, the materials used in flat-foam roofing are often recyclable, and the seamless application reduces the likelihood of leaks and the need for frequent repairs, which can reduce waste and environmental impact.

What are the eco-friendly benefits of single ply roofing?

Single ply roofing is considered eco-friendly because the materials used are often recyclable and can be manufactured with minimal environmental impact. Additionally, the reflective properties of some single ply membranes can reduce the building’s energy consumption by reflecting sunlight and reducing the need for air conditioning.
